overctrl All Posts AI Best Practices Career Developer Experience (DX) Documentation Fundamentals JavaScript News Performance & Optimization Productivity ReactJS Security Stories Tech in Business Tech Trends Testing Tooling TypeScript Web Development Posts 6 min read Advanced Error Handling in TypeScript: Best Practices and Common Pitfalls Marcos Gonçalves Marcos Gonçalves Feb 17, 2025 • Best Practices • JavaScript • TypeScript 5 min read Enhancing React DX: A Unified HTML Component Marcos Gonçalves Marcos Gonçalves Feb 12, 2025 • Web Development • Developer Experience (DX) • TypeScript 6 min read 6 Programming Principles Every Developer Should Know Marcos Gonçalves Marcos Gonçalves Feb 10, 2025 • Web Development • Best Practices • Fundamentals 4 min read WeakMap vs WeakSet in JavaScript: Everything You Need to Know Marcos Gonçalves Marcos Gonçalves Feb 5, 2025 • Web Development • JavaScript • Fundamentals 6 min read Understanding JavaScript Symbols: Beyond Strings and Numbers Marcos Gonçalves Marcos Gonçalves Feb 3, 2025 • Web Development • JavaScript • Fundamentals 6 min read Building Universal UI Components: Embracing the Right Level of Abstraction and Zero Dependencies Marcos Gonçalves Marcos Gonçalves Jan 29, 2025 • Developer Experience (DX) • Fundamentals • Performance & Optimization 5 min read 9 Critical Web App Vulnerabilities and How to Prevent Them Marcos Gonçalves Marcos Gonçalves Jan 27, 2025 • Security • Web Development • Tech in Business 4 min read Failing to Test? Here’s How It Could Cost Your Business Millions Marcos Gonçalves Marcos Gonçalves Jan 21, 2025 • Career • Tech in Business • Stories 4 min read Mastering TypeScript Type Inference Marcos Gonçalves Marcos Gonçalves Jan 19, 2025 • TypeScript • Web Development • Best Practices 3 min read React’s Next Big Moves: Key Developer Proposals You Need to Know Marcos Gonçalves Marcos Gonçalves Jan 15, 2025 • ReactJS • Web Development • Developer Experience (DX) 5 min read When Code Ages: The Hidden Force of Software Entropy Marcos Gonçalves Marcos Gonçalves Jan 12, 2025 • Documentation • Tech in Business • Career 4 min read TypeScript Nullable Types Explained: Your Comprehensive Guide with Code Examples Marcos Gonçalves Marcos Gonçalves Jan 8, 2025 • TypeScript • Web Development • Best Practices Load More You've reached the end of the list
6 min read Advanced Error Handling in TypeScript: Best Practices and Common Pitfalls Marcos Gonçalves Marcos Gonçalves Feb 17, 2025 • Best Practices • JavaScript • TypeScript
5 min read Enhancing React DX: A Unified HTML Component Marcos Gonçalves Marcos Gonçalves Feb 12, 2025 • Web Development • Developer Experience (DX) • TypeScript
6 min read 6 Programming Principles Every Developer Should Know Marcos Gonçalves Marcos Gonçalves Feb 10, 2025 • Web Development • Best Practices • Fundamentals
4 min read WeakMap vs WeakSet in JavaScript: Everything You Need to Know Marcos Gonçalves Marcos Gonçalves Feb 5, 2025 • Web Development • JavaScript • Fundamentals
6 min read Understanding JavaScript Symbols: Beyond Strings and Numbers Marcos Gonçalves Marcos Gonçalves Feb 3, 2025 • Web Development • JavaScript • Fundamentals
6 min read Building Universal UI Components: Embracing the Right Level of Abstraction and Zero Dependencies Marcos Gonçalves Marcos Gonçalves Jan 29, 2025 • Developer Experience (DX) • Fundamentals • Performance & Optimization
5 min read 9 Critical Web App Vulnerabilities and How to Prevent Them Marcos Gonçalves Marcos Gonçalves Jan 27, 2025 • Security • Web Development • Tech in Business
4 min read Failing to Test? Here’s How It Could Cost Your Business Millions Marcos Gonçalves Marcos Gonçalves Jan 21, 2025 • Career • Tech in Business • Stories
4 min read Mastering TypeScript Type Inference Marcos Gonçalves Marcos Gonçalves Jan 19, 2025 • TypeScript • Web Development • Best Practices
3 min read React’s Next Big Moves: Key Developer Proposals You Need to Know Marcos Gonçalves Marcos Gonçalves Jan 15, 2025 • ReactJS • Web Development • Developer Experience (DX)
5 min read When Code Ages: The Hidden Force of Software Entropy Marcos Gonçalves Marcos Gonçalves Jan 12, 2025 • Documentation • Tech in Business • Career
4 min read TypeScript Nullable Types Explained: Your Comprehensive Guide with Code Examples Marcos Gonçalves Marcos Gonçalves Jan 8, 2025 • TypeScript • Web Development • Best Practices